Hi,
I'll be DMing a game in a few weeks and one player has expressed wanting to play an auramancer.
My problem is that I can't find anything in pathfinder or 3.5 that could be considered an auramancer, does anyone know where I could find something that would fit? Has anyone played anything like this before? I wouldn't mind homebrewing something to work but does anyone have any ideas on what said classes special abilities or spells would be?

one idea you could go as is psionics. go as a seer/telepath (Psion) possibly even house ruling a way to combine the two together. The biggest thing you really need to worry about is what spells or powers you go. with the massive selection on spells and powers, going anything like a seer/oracle/cleric/wizard/sorcerer could give you the ability to do what your looking for. The biggest thing is look for spells that affect the mind of your opponents (mind effecting) or scry.
Second note. auramancer is a term that means a char that kills things around the char with arura spells and the like without actually attacking.

There are a couple psionic powers that do this kind of thing. I'm a little short on time to post them now, unfortunately. The problem is there aren't many and the ones I'm thinking of are a couple levels up on the lists. (can't remember exact names right off unfortunately). If you're willing to homebrew I'd say keep an eye on resource use and the lack there-of. This kind of concept seems like it would lend itself to imbalance easily if you don't watch it just because auras tend to not use slots or use/x as most other things do.
